    Gun Show Trash or Treasures?

    I wandered the smaller of two shows yesterday. I found some things that I found interesting to me, but I wasn't sure if it was trash or treasure.

    First, I found a BM59 tricompensator, 5" or so, little remaining finish. Seller wanted $140. Should I try to buy it or pass?

    Second, I found an IHC stock with metal. The stock was sanded. DAS is visible. numbers and a letter in barrel channel. Seller wants $150. Buy or pass?

    Third was a USGI? tool made to re-thread the gas block on M1 carbines. $75 OBO. It is the whole set up with the device that holds the barrel and the taps.

    Last, several Smith Corona barrels. One looked like NOS, the other was clearly off of a rifle. Both had ME of 1.5. The first barrel was minty other than handling marks. The other had a small amount of pitting under the wood. Both had front sight bases but no blades. Each was $200. Your thoughts?
